PER CURIAM:

This is an appeal from a judgment entered in favor of respondent upon findings of fact and conclusions of law, based upon stipulated facts, in an action for forcible detainer instituted pursuant to RCW 59.12.020(2). The parties are farmers who for several years have occupied adjoining farms in Whitman county.
